Daniels set up a tie with county cup holders
Stamford AFC have earned a crack at Lincs Senior Cup holders Gainsborough Trinity in the second round of this season’s competition.
The Daniels saw off Grantham Town 4-1 in a first round tie at the Zeeco Stadium on Monday night with goals from Jon Challinor, Taron Hare and two visiting players.
Stamford are back in action next Tuesday (July 17) against Corby in a home friendly.
Peterborough Premier Division champions Netherton United started their summer friendly programme with a 5-1 home win over top-flight newcomers Peterborough Polonia. Mark Baines and returning star Fraser Sturgess were among the scorers.
